According to her record of death, she was the daughter of Patrick Griffin (or possibly Griffy) and married at the time of her death. She was born in Ireland, possibly on the island of Inisheer (Inis Oirr), the easternmost of the Aran Islands. If she was indeed born on Inisheer, she almost certainly spoke Gaelic as her first language.
It is possible, though not certain, that Bridget used the nickname Biddy.
The date of birth entered here is an estimate based on her stated age (62) at death. This birthdate, however, makes her age at the birth of her last known child 47 years, which seems unlikely.
There is another possible source for Bridget, her age, parentage and family. The 1821 Ireland Census records a family by the name of Griffy living on Inisheer headed by Pat Griffy, age 61. Also included in the family are Pat's wife, Biddy, age 56; their sons John Griffy, age 20 and Bryan, age 16; an orphan grandson named Micheal Kean, age 10, two house servants, and the family of Pat and Biddy's daughter, also named Biddy. This family is headed by John Maher, age 36. Pat and Biddy's daughter is now called Biddy Maher, and her age given as 29. This would put her year of birth at 1792. John and Biddy have a three-year-old son named Tom Maher. [1]
Bridget died 13 Apr 1859 at Medford Street, Charlestown, Middlesex County, Massachusetts. Cause of death was disease of the spine and she was 62 at the time of death. [2] [3] [4]
Bridget and her husband John were both buried at Holyhood Cemetery, Brookline, Norfolk County, Massachusetts, USA. She was buried 16 Apr 1859, and he was buried 6 Jul 1862. [5] Bridget's residence at time of death was 353 Medford Street, Charlestown. Her age at the time of death was 62. Burial location is on Cross Avenue or West Avenue (not far from the cemetery entrance on Heath Street), graves 125-127. Cemetery deed # 91086 dated 16 Apr 1859, owner Meagher, John, care Perpetual. There was a Bridget Griffin in the 1850 US Census of Hanover, Chautauqua County, NY, born in Ireland about 1797, [9] but she is not the same person, as Bridget Agnes Griffin married John Augustus Meagher in 1814.
There was a Bridget Meagher in the 1860 US Census of Malden, Middlesex County, Massachusetts, born in Ireland about 1797, [10] but she is not the same person, as Bridget Agnes Meagher died in 1859 and her husband's name was John, not James.

There was a Bridget Meagher in the 1870 US Census of Franklin, Somerset County, NJ, born in Ireland about 1797, [11] but she is not the same person, as Bridget Agnes Meagher died in 1859.
